风雨哈佛路,做一个心怀期待的Developer

一棵菜菜 发布的文章

js常见的两种垃圾回收方法—引用计数和标记清除

引用计数原理在低版本IE中经常会出现内存泄露,很多时候就是因为其采用引用计数方式进行垃圾回收。引用计数的策略是跟踪记录每个值被使用的次数,当声明了一个变量并将一个引用类型赋值给该变量的时候这个值的引用次数就加1,如果该变量的值变成了另外一个,则这个值得引用次数减1,当这个值的引用次数变为0的时候,说明没有变量在使用,这个值没法被访问了,因此可以将其占用的空间回收,这样垃圾回收器会在运行的时候...

JS跨域

推荐看我的思维导图《跨域》强烈推荐官方文档《HTTP访问控制(CORS)》推荐官方文档《window.postMessage》1. 为什么会出现"跨域"的问题?因为浏览器的同源策略导致了跨域,就是浏览器在搞事情~~~ 是浏览器做的一件好事~~~2. 同源策略同源或同域:即协议、域名、端口都必须相同。http://caiyichen.me:8080 协议 域名 端口号由...
April 23, 2018

vue响应式(双响绑定)原理

Vue简介Vue.js 不是一个框架,它只是一个提供 MVVM 风格的双向数据绑定的库,专注于 UI 层面。Vue.js 可以说是MVVM 架构的最佳实践,专注于 MVVM 中的 ViewModel,不仅做到了数据双向绑定,而且也是一款相对比较轻量级的JS 库,API 简洁,很容易上手。
April 20, 2018

vue 中使用postCss

下载// postcss 的命令行工具 // sudo cnpm install -g postcss-cli // 先安装一下需要的库 npm install postcss --save // autoprefixer 插件 npm install autoprefixer --save // precss 插件 npm install precss --save配置在vue-loa...

postcss-js的基本使用

What: 什么是postcssPostCSS 是一个允许使用 JS 插件转换样式的工具。 这些插件可以检查(lint)你的 CSS,支持 CSS Variables 和 Mixins, 编译尚未被浏览器广泛支持的先进的 CSS 语法,内联图片,以及其它很多优秀的功能。 PostCSS 在工业界被广泛地应用,其中不乏很多有名的行业领导者,如:维基百科,Twitter,阿里巴巴, JetBr...

brootstrap可视化拖拽布局调研

概述在线操作网址:http://www.bootcss.com/p/layoutit/主要是使用插件jquery-ui-draggable和jquery-ui-sortable的配合实现拖拽和排序。插件文档jquery-ui-draggable:http://www.runoob.com/jqueryui/api-draggable.html。jquery-ui-sortable:http:...

编辑器v2.0前端项目开发规范

说明作者:蔡依辰介绍:此文档为v2版的前端开发规范,部分基于vue的开发规范。文件规范只要有能够拼接文件的构建系统,就把每个组件单独分成文件。components/ |- TodoList.vue |- TodoItem.vue完整单词的组件名组件名应该倾向于完整单词而不是缩写。// 反例 components/ |- SdSettings.vue |- UProfOpts.vue // 好...

wix编辑器组件属性调研

描述:wix.com 编辑器中所有组件的属性和功能分析。作者:蔡依辰。文本属性是否可借鉴功能是否可借鉴文字内容-动画-文字(主题,字体,字体大小,加粗,斜体,下划线,前景色,背景色,链接,对齐方式,列表,左缩进,右缩进,对齐方式。)---效果(内置多种效果)---字间距(自动/自定义)---图片属性是否可借鉴功能是否可借鉴图片地址-裁剪(按固定比例/自定义比例)-当图片被点击时的操作(无/打...

小程序商品分类排序(包括新思路)

作者:蔡依辰说明:对小程序商品分类、首页的轮播图和快捷按钮功能,在添加、拖拽排序时获取sort值,并按sort值从大到小排列。思路分类是按自上而下、按sort值从大到小的顺序排列。分类sort值图:添加分类时获取其sort值添加时,即向队列中push数据,添加项的sort值=分类列表中最大的sort值+SORT_ADD_UNIT_NUM。注意:首次添加时,可以将分类列表中最大的sort值看做...

prismjs代码高亮插件的使用教程

1、prismjs代码高亮插件:简介:一个 JavaScript 库 —— Prism 是一款轻量、可扩展的代码语法高亮库,使用现代化的 Web 标准构建。参考文档:(1)http://prismjs.com/(2)中文:http://c7sky.com/syntax-highlighting-with-prismjs.html2、教程: